ocra-recipes
Doxygen documentation for the ocra-recipes repository
oc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o > Member List

This is the complete list of members for oc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>, including all inherited members.

Component()oc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>inlineprotected
component_t typedefoc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>
const_iterator typedefoc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>
getNumParenthoods() const oc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>inline
getParenthood(size_t i) const oc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>inline
isAncestorOf(const ComponentDerived &node) const =0oc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>pure virtual
isChildOf(const CompositeDerived &node)oc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>inline
isDescendantOf(const CompositeDerived &node) const oc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>inline
isDescendantOf(const ComponentDerived &node) const oc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>inline
iterator typedefoc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>
onAttachedParent(const parenthood_t &parent)oc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>inlineprotectedvirtual
onDetachedParent(const parenthood_t &parent)oc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>inlineprotectedvirtual
parent_t typedefoc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>
Parenthood< ComponentDerived, CompositeDerived, ParenthoodInfo > classoc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>friend
parenthood_t typedefoc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>
parents_begin() const oc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>inline
parents_begin()oc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>inline
parents_end() const oc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>inline
parents_end()oc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>inline
printNode(int depth, std::ostream &os) const =0oc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>pure virtual
printSubTree(int depth, std::ostream &os) const =0oc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>pure virtual
printTree(std::ostream &os)oc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>inline
~Component()ocra::Component< ComponentDerived, CompositeDerived, ParenthoodInfo >inlineprotected